Research Summary
Active Optical Cable (AOC) is a technology that uses fiber optic cable to transmit high-speed data signals over long distances. AOC cables are designed to provide faster and more efficient data transmission over traditional copper cables. The cable consists of a transceiver at each end and fiber optic cables in between that convert electrical signals into optical signals and back again. AOCs are commonly used in data centers, high-speed networking, and multimedia applications. They offer several benefits, including high bandwidth, low power consumption, and immunity to electromagnetic interference.
